Part of Dentsu Group, Dentsu International is a network designed for what’s next, helping clients predict and plan for disruptive future opportunities and create new paths to growth in the sustainable economy. Dentsu delivers people-focused solutions and services to drive better business and societal outcomes. This is delivered through five global leadership brands - Carat, Dentsu Creative, dentsu X, iProspect and Merkle, each with deep specialisms.
Dentsu International’s radically collaborative team of diverse creators unifies people, clients and capabilities through horizontal creativity to help clients create culture, change society, and invent the future.
Powered by 100% renewable energy, Dentsu International operates in over 145 markets worldwide with more than 46,000 dedicated specialists, and partners with 95 of the top 100 global advertisers.

What your typical day will look like:
The Executive Business Manager supports the Cluster CEO by acting as an intermediary for both internal and external issues as well as helping to interpret, act, delegate and manage the CEO’s needs and time effectively. The Executive Business Manager is responsible for understanding and assisting the CEO ANZ in driving and delivering on key strategic business priorities. In this role, the Executive Business Manager serves as a partner to the Cluster CEO supporting key initiatives to enhance collaboration, connection and communication across the business. The Executive Business Manager leads efforts to ensure consistent ways of working and information flow across teams, practices and the business. By effectively anticipating the CEO’s needs, the Executive Business Manager ensures seamless operations through efficient schedule management, effective communication, and collaboration with internal and external stakeholders to advance critical initiatives. This role combines leadership, strategic planning, and hands-on support to foster productivity, optimise workflows and maintain the highest levels of professionalism.
Other responsibilities include:
- Support the CEO, ANZ by acting as an intermediary for both internal and external issues. Act as the first point of contact with clients, internal staff and other external parties including some media, regarding matters which call for the CEO’s attention
- Support the CEO by overseeing and driving all matters pertaining to the CEO’s office whilst being able to work independently and take initiative
- Keep CEO, ANZ informed of commitments, priorities and internal inquiries and ensure CEO, ANZ is fully prepared
- Build strong and positive stakeholder relationships providing high quality customer service and high-level administrative support
- Co-ordinate and manage relevant responses and/or input into projects, programs, reports, presentations, correspondence, and departmental/business issues
- Proactively manage the CEO’s time including communications (email), meetings, events, and travel, often across multiple time-zones. Scheduling appointments with clients and industry partners.
- Coach, mentor, engage and develop the EA community, including overseeing new employee on-boarding and providing career development planning and learning opportunities
- Handling Invoice Processing, Diary management, agendas for meetings, travel coordination, booking accommodation and preparing detailed itineraries
- Act as conduit between the Communications team, People team and the office of the CEO to facilitate strategic communications across the business.
- Operational cadence and ways of working - Implement effective ways of working practices and processes that will continuously optimise business effectiveness and enable teams.
